Q: Is 105,252,253 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 105,252,253 is a composite number.

Why is 105,252,253 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 105,252,253 can be evenly divided by 1 17 79 109 719 1,343 1,853 8,611 12,223 56,801 78,371 146,387 965,617 1,332,307 6,191,309 and 105,252,253, with no remainder.

Since 105,252,253 cannot be divided by just 1 and 105,252,253, it is a composite number.
